You should always incorporate protein into your diet for the day whether you've been off for a couple days or not. Your body grows when you're resting, not when you're in the gym and taking in protein on your off days is just as important as on days when you're in the gym. Honestly, other some slight tweaking pre and post workout, my diet stays constant whether I'm training that day or not. Consistancy is key.

My advice:

Eat a high protein, low glycemic meal immediately and then drink at least 18 oz water. Go do it right now...

After 1-2 hours do it again and repeat, do this until about 90-120 min before you workout

After your workout get in about 75-100g carbs with 50g of protein and consume it gradually within hour. Then eat real food and hour later

im trying to lose weight, is carbs after my workout really required??
Yes, because you have to replace glycogen stores in your muscles; just don't go crazy with them. Even High GI carbs are okay, but you sort of have to play around for a bit to see how much you can take in while still cutting at a reasonable rate. Post-workout is actually the time to take in simple carbs, so enjoy it. lol
